set(MIN_NODE_VERSION "14.00.0")
# Clean up directory
file(REMOVE_RECURSE ${PYTHON_PACKAGE_DST_DIR})
file(MAKE_DIRECTORY ${PYTHON_PACKAGE_DST_DIR}/open3d)
# Create python package. It contains:
# 1) Pure-python code and misc files, copied from ${PYTHON_PACKAGE_SRC_DIR}
# 2) The compiled python-C++ module, i.e. open3d.so (or the equivalents)
# Optionally other modules e.g. open3d_tf_ops.so may be included.
# 3) Configured files and supporting files
# 1) Pure-python code and misc files, copied from ${PYTHON_PACKAGE_SRC_DIR}
file(COPY ${PYTHON_PACKAGE_SRC_DIR}/
DESTINATION ${PYTHON_PACKAGE_DST_DIR}
)
# 2) The compiled python-C++ module, i.e. open3d.so (or the equivalents)
# Optionally other modules e.g. open3d_tf_ops.so may be included.
# Folder structure is base_dir/{cpu|cuda}/{pybind*.so|open3d_{torch|tf}_ops.so},
# so copy base_dir directly to ${PYTHON_PACKAGE_DST_DIR}/open3d
foreach(COMPILED_MODULE_PATH ${COMPILED_MODULE_PATH_LIST})
get_filename_component(COMPILED_MODULE_NAME ${COMPILED_MODULE_PATH} NAME)
get_filename_component(COMPILED_MODULE_ARCH_DIR ${COMPILED_MODULE_PATH} DIRECTORY)
get_filename_component(COMPILED_MODULE_BASE_DIR ${COMPILED_MODULE_ARCH_DIR} DIRECTORY)
foreach(ARCH cpu cuda)
if(IS_DIRECTORY "${COMPILED_MODULE_BASE_DIR}/${ARCH}")
file(INSTALL "${COMPILED_MODULE_BASE_DIR}/${ARCH}/" DESTINATION
"${PYTHON_PACKAGE_DST_DIR}/open3d/${ARCH}"
FILES_MATCHING PATTERN "${COMPILED_MODULE_NAME}")
endif()
endforeach()
endforeach()
# Include additional libraries that may be absent from the user system
# eg: libc++.so and libc++abi.so (needed by filament)
# The linker recognizes only library.so.MAJOR, so remove .MINOR from the filename
foreach(PYTHON_EXTRA_LIB ${PYTHON_EXTRA_LIBRARIES})
get_filename_component(PYTHON_EXTRA_LIB_REAL ${PYTHON_EXTRA_LIB} REALPATH)
get_filename_component(SO_VER_NAME ${PYTHON_EXTRA_LIB_REAL} NAME)
if (APPLE)
string(REGEX REPLACE "\\.([0-9]+)\\..*.dylib" ".\\1.dylib" SO_1_NAME ${SO_VER_NAME})
elseif (UNIX)
string(REGEX REPLACE "\\.so\\.([0-9]+)\\..*" ".so.\\1" SO_1_NAME ${SO_VER_NAME})
endif()
configure_file(${PYTHON_EXTRA_LIB_REAL} ${PYTHON_PACKAGE_DST_DIR}/open3d/${SO_1_NAME} COPYONLY)
endforeach()
# 3) Configured files and supporting files
configure_file("${PYTHON_PACKAGE_SRC_DIR}/setup.py"
"${PYTHON_PACKAGE_DST_DIR}/setup.py")
configure_file("${PYTHON_PACKAGE_SRC_DIR}/open3d/__init__.py"
"${PYTHON_PACKAGE_DST_DIR}/open3d/__init__.py")
configure_file("${PYTHON_PACKAGE_SRC_DIR}/tools/cli.py"
"${PYTHON_PACKAGE_DST_DIR}/open3d/tools/cli.py")
configure_file("${PYTHON_PACKAGE_SRC_DIR}/tools/app.py"
"${PYTHON_PACKAGE_DST_DIR}/open3d/app.py")
configure_file("${PYTHON_PACKAGE_SRC_DIR}/open3d/web_visualizer.py"
"${PYTHON_PACKAGE_DST_DIR}/open3d/web_visualizer.py")
configure_file("${PYTHON_PACKAGE_SRC_DIR}/js/lib/web_visualizer.js"
"${PYTHON_PACKAGE_DST_DIR}/js/lib/web_visualizer.js")
configure_file("${PYTHON_PACKAGE_SRC_DIR}/js/package.json"
"${PYTHON_PACKAGE_DST_DIR}/js/package.json")
configure_file("${PYTHON_PACKAGE_SRC_DIR}/../cpp/open3d/visualization/webrtc_server/html/webrtcstreamer.js"
"${PYTHON_PACKAGE_DST_DIR}/js/lib/webrtcstreamer.js")
file(COPY "${PYTHON_COMPILED_MODULE_DIR}/_build_config.py"
DESTINATION "${PYTHON_PACKAGE_DST_DIR}/open3d/")
if (BUILD_TENSORFLOW_OPS OR BUILD_PYTORCH_OPS)
# copy generated files
file(COPY "${PYTHON_PACKAGE_DST_DIR}/../ml"
DESTINATION "${PYTHON_PACKAGE_DST_DIR}/open3d/" )
endif()
if (BUNDLE_OPEN3D_ML)
file(COPY "${PYTHON_PACKAGE_DST_DIR}/../../open3d_ml/src/open3d_ml/ml3d"
DESTINATION "${PYTHON_PACKAGE_DST_DIR}/open3d/" )
file(RENAME "${PYTHON_PACKAGE_DST_DIR}/open3d/ml3d" "${PYTHON_PACKAGE_DST_DIR}/open3d/_ml3d")
endif()
# Build Jupyter plugin.
if (BUILD_JUPYTER_EXTENSION)
if (WIN32 OR UNIX AND NOT LINUX_AARCH64)
message(STATUS "Jupyter support is enabled, building Jupyter plugin now.")
else()
message(FATAL_ERROR "Jupyter plugin is not supported on ARM.")
endif()
find_program(NODE node)
if (NODE)
message(STATUS "node found at: ${NODE}")
else()
message(STATUS "node not found.")
message(FATAL_ERROR "Please install Node.js."
"Visit https://nodejs.org/en/download/package-manager/ for details."
"For ubuntu, we recommend getting the latest version of Node.js from"
"https://github.com/nodesource/distributions/blob/master/README.md#installation-instructions.")
endif()
execute_process(COMMAND "${NODE}" --version
OUTPUT_VARIABLE NODE_VERSION
OUTPUT_STRIP_TRAILING_WHITESPACE)
STRING(REGEX REPLACE "v" "" NODE_VERSION ${NODE_VERSION})
message(STATUS "node version: ${NODE_VERSION}")
if (NODE_VERSION VERSION_LESS ${MIN_NODE_VERSION})
message(FATAL_ERROR "node version ${NODE_VERSION} is too old. "
"Please upgrade to ${MIN_NODE_VERSION} or higher.")
endif()
find_program(YARN yarn)
if (YARN)
message(STATUS "yarn found at: ${YARN}")
else()
message(FATAL_ERROR "yarn not found. You may install yarm globally by "
"npm install -g yarn.")
endif()
# Append requirements_jupyter_install.txt to requirements.txt
# These will be installed when `pip install open3d`.
execute_process(COMMAND ${CMAKE_COMMAND} -E cat
${PYTHON_PACKAGE_SRC_DIR}/requirements.txt
${PYTHON_PACKAGE_SRC_DIR}/requirements_jupyter_install.txt
OUTPUT_VARIABLE ALL_REQUIREMENTS
)
# The double-quote "" is important as it keeps the semicolons.
file(WRITE ${PYTHON_PACKAGE_DST_DIR}/requirements.txt "${ALL_REQUIREMENTS}")
endif()
if (BUILD_GUI)
file(MAKE_DIRECTORY "${PYTHON_PACKAGE_DST_DIR}/open3d/resources/")
file(COPY ${GUI_RESOURCE_DIR}
DESTINATION "${PYTHON_PACKAGE_DST_DIR}/open3d/")
endif()
# Add all examples to installation directory.
file(MAKE_DIRECTORY "${PYTHON_PACKAGE_DST_DIR}/open3d/examples/")
file(COPY "${PYTHON_PACKAGE_SRC_DIR}/../examples/python/"
DESTINATION "${PYTHON_PACKAGE_DST_DIR}/open3d/examples")
file(COPY "${PYTHON_PACKAGE_SRC_DIR}/../examples/python/"
DESTINATION "${PYTHON_PACKAGE_DST_DIR}/open3d/examples")
# Generate typing stub files (.pyi) and py.typed marker file.
if(WITH_STUBGEN)
if(NOT IGNORE_STUBGEN_ERRORS)
list(APPEND PYBIND11_STUBGEN_FLAGS "--exit-code")
endif()
message(STATUS "Generating typing stubs...")
execute_process(
COMMAND ${CMAKE_COMMAND} -E env PYTHONPATH=${PYTHON_PACKAGE_DST_DIR} pybind11-stubgen open3d -o ${PYTHON_PACKAGE_DST_DIR} ${PYBIND11_STUBGEN_FLAGS}
COMMAND_ECHO STDOUT
COMMAND_ERROR_IS_FATAL ANY
)
file(WRITE "${PYTHON_PACKAGE_DST_DIR}/open3d/py.typed")
endif()
